cho tệp 'lop11a12.inp' chứa các số nguyên,mỗi số nằm trên một dòng.hãy cho biết có bao nhiêu số chẵn trong tệp trên . mọi người làm mình vs ??

2 câu trả lời

uses crt;
var f,g:text;
    a:array[1..1000] of integer;
    n,i,cs:byte;
Begin
write('Nhap so cac so can doc: '); readln(n);
assign(f,'lop11a12.inp');
reset(f);
for i:=1 to n do
 readln(f,a[i]);
for i:=1 to n do
 if a[i] mod 2 =0 then cs:=cs+1;
write('Co ',cs,' so chan');
close(f);
readln;

End.

program bai_giai;
uses crt;
var f:text;
    n,d:longint;
begin
    clrscr;
    Assign(f,'lop11a12.inp');  reset(f);
    d:=0;
    while not eof(f) do
        begin
            readln(f,n);
            if n mod 2=0 then d:=d+1;
        end;
    write(d);
    close(f); readln;
end.

Câu hỏi trong lớp Xem thêm